CEGEP halfback recently commits to Vanier Cup Champions’ 2014 class.
It wasnβt an easy decision for one CEGEP standout, but he finally made it.
Recently, Raphael Robidoux-Bouchard committed to the Vanier Cup Champions, Laval Rouge et Or.Β The 6β2, 195 pound halfback will joins the team for the 2014 RSEQ season.
βMy decision of going with the Rouge et Or was a difficult decision due to my experiences in Montreal with Sun Youth and the CVM Spartiates,β reflected Robidoux-Bouchard.Β βFabrice Raymond who is the Defensive Backs Coach with the Carabins, was my coach for three years with the Spartiates.β
βWhat helped me to make my decision was the fact that Laval University is giving me the program of my choice (sportive intervention) and of course I want to be part of the best team in the country.β
The Quebec standout recently completed his CEGEP career with Division 1 team, Vieux Montreal Spartiates.Β In 2013, he registered 32 tackles including three for a loss, three deflected passes and a forced fumble.Β This was a comeback from the 2012 season, which Robidoux-Bouchard had to sit out with a torn ACL injury. He also served as captain of the team last season.
